快捷键问题?

VC/MFC > 基础类 [问题点数:20分,结帖人huaboy408]
等级
本版专家分:12971
结帖率 100%
huaboy408

等级:

hive: 空值、NULL判断、空值的处理

hive中空判断基本分两种 (1)NULL 与 \N hive在底层数据中如何保存和标识NULL,是由 alter table name SET SERDEPROPERTIES('serialization.null.format' = '\N'); 参数控制的 比如: 1.设置 alter table ...

Hive--对空值和NULL的处理

Hive中默认将NULL存为\N,NULL类型的字符串如何检索? 创建一个测试及准备测试数据,SQL如下: create table test_null (id int, age string) ROW FORMAT DELIMITED FIELDS TERMINATED BY ',' LINES ...

hiveNULL值问题

在oracle中的NULL值迁移到hive中后有的字段表现为NULL,有的字段表现为空串“”(即两个引号中间为空)。观察发现字符型的数据字段为空串,非字符型的字段为NULL。 整个链路涉及到了oracle、cdm、hive,分析问题的...

详解:Hive中的NULL的处理、优点、使用情况(注意)

Hive中的NULL的处理、优点、使用情况 一:Hive中的NULL hive的使用中不可避免的需要对null、‘’(空字符串)进行判断识别。但是hive又别于传统的数据库。 1.不同数据类型对空值的存储规则 int与string类型数据存储,...

HiveNULL的含义

Hive中,NULL表示的是异常,与null不同,文件中的nullHive中被认为字符串,如果对应的字段类型是字符类的,如string,则将其视为一个普通的字符串,而对于数据类的,则若数据本身是null,则由于无法转换为数值,...

HiveNULL值(空值)处理

hive null null默认的存储都是\N,可以在建表时通过serialization.null.format的设置 null不能进行算术运算,所有有null参与的运算结果都为null hive> select null+2; OK NULL同样null=0,null!=0这类结果都为null,...

hive 空值、NULL判断

hive空值、NULL判断以及存储

hive中使用is null和is not null问题

在使用HQL时如果有空值喜欢追随SQL99的规范使用IS NULL 和IS NO

HIVENULL值的处理

HIVENULL值的处理

hive中的NULL(hive空值处理)

HIVE表中默认将NULL存为\N,可查看的源文件(hadoop fs -cat或者hadoop fs -text),文件中存储大量\N, 这样造成浪费大量空间。而且用java、python直接进入路径操作源数据时,解析也要注意。另外,hive表的源文件...

hive导入数据出现NULL

由于很多数据在hadoop平台,当从hadoop平台的数据迁移到hive目录下时,由于hive默认的分隔符是/u0001,为了平滑迁移,需要在创建表格时指定数据的分割符号,语法如下:  create table test(uid string,name ...

hive isnull或ifnull的替代方法if()方法

hive isnull或ifnull的替代方法if()方法 hive没有isnull和ifnull函数,可以用if()函数替代 if(条件,1,2) 条件为真:1,否则2(相当于c++里的三目运算?:) select if(column2 is null, 0, cslt.self_...

Hive分区新增字段为null的bug及解决方法

Hive分区新增字段为null的bug及解决方法

hive 空值、null判断

hive中空判断基本分两种 (1)NULL 与 \N hive在底层数据中如何保存和标识NULL,是由 alter table name SET SERDEPROPERTIES('serialization.null.format' = '\N'); 参数控制的 比如: 1.设置 alter table...

Hive对有null值得一列做avg,count等操作时会过滤掉有NULL值的这一行

(SELECT null as col1 union all SELECT 2 as col1 union all SELECT 4 as col1 ) SELECT avg(1) from tmp 结果是3; WITH tmp AS (SELECT null as col1 union all SELECT 2 as col1 union

深入解析hive中的NULL(空值)和''(空字符串)

一、hive里面的 null(空值) 和 ''(空字符串) 是两个不同的东西 1、如果查某个字段【 a 是否为空】应该...在hive的数据中,null值(空值)较为常见,比如字段没有值,就是所谓的null值(空值),而 ''(空字符串)...

hive 中,Load data导入多出现一列null或者全部数据都是null

出现一列null原因:导入的文件编码问题,需要设置成utf8,(如果改了编码,还是出现一列null,就把分隔符由/t 改成英文逗号,)     导入的数据全部都是null,原因:createtable时需要指定, row formate ...

Hive中rlike,like,not like,regexp区别与使用详解

1.like的使用详解 1.语法规则: 格式是A like B,其中A是字符串,B是表达式,表示能否用B去完全匹配A的内容,换句话说能否用B这个表达式去表示A的全部内容,注意这个和rlike是有区别的。返回的结果是True/False. ...

Hdfs 导入Hive,时间相关的字段 导入后为NULL

CREATE TABLE OFFER_${day_id} ( OFFER_ID BIGINT, ATOM_ACTION_ID BIGINT, PARTY_ID BIGINT, OFFER_SPEC_ID BIGINT, OFFER_NBR STRING, AREA_ID INT, MKT_ACTIVITY_ID BIGINT, START_DT STRING, ...

hive 空值的处理

hive的使用中不可避免的需要对null、‘’(空字符串)进行判断识别。但是hive有别于传统的数据库。 下面一一说明: (1)不同数据类型对空值的存储规则 int与string类型数据存储,null默认存储为 \N; string...

Sqoop导入hive数据库NULL值处理

最近用sqoop将mysql的一张导入到hive中,发现以前is null的字段导入到hive的时候,被转换为了字符串’NULL’或’null’。 当导入的时候加上–direct选项的时候,null值导入变成了字符串’NULL’,命令如下:sqoop ...

hive表中字段显示为NULL时,HDFS文件中存储为\N

今天遇到个问题:  利用java程序从云梯上读文件,解析出来的内容,会出现null,和\N。 1. 字符串null是因为,当字段=‘’时,存储为null。利用命令  alter table adl_cici_test_fdt set serdeproperties('...

hive分区增加字段新增字段为空的bug

关键字: hive, partition, add column ...最近在查hive版本问题,发现在hive1.1.0和hive1.2.1上,分区新增字段后新增字段为空的情况。 网上查了资料,提供了两种解决办法: 1. 修改hive元数据SDS的CD_ID字段,

[Hive]Hive使用指南七 空值与NULL

1. NULL(null)创建一个临时tmp_null_empty_test,并插入一些NULL数据:CREATE TABLE IF NOT EXISTS tmp_null_empty_test( uid string ) ROW FORMAT DELIMITED FIELDS TERMINATED BY '\t' LINES TERMINATED BY '\...

爬坑:hiveNULL值过滤

hive的底层保存的是’NULL’是个字符串,想要过滤掉NULL值,使用is not null无效 insert overwrite local directory '/home/hadoop/zoujc/result' select distinct username from xxxtable where lower...

Hive分区中 添加新字段,NULL 问题解决

Hive分区中 添加字段,NULL 问题解决

Hive总结(六)的三种连接方式

0.数据源hive> SELECT * FROM test; id_name 9 Nermaer 31 JiaJia 10 Messi 16 Santi 6 Tian 21 Pirlo hive> SELECT * FROM test_name; 26 Santi 26 Tian 99 xiaozha991内连接 *SELECE a.,b.* FROM

hive---nvl函数

nvl函数:空值转换函数函数形式:nvl(expr1,expr2),类似于mysql-nullif(expr1,expr2)作用:将查询为Null值转换为指定值。若expr1为Null,则返回expr2,否则返回expr1。适用于数字型、字符型和日期型,但是...

Hive分区新增字段数据显示为NULL

hive的分区在新增字段后,新增字段的数据显示NULLhive分区新增字段,新分区字段能够显示,老的分区字段无法显示,在hdfs上显示正常。 测试具体情况: 1、创建一个测试 2、插入一条数据 ...

hive GROUPING SETS通过GROUPING__ID 得到聚合的字段

当我们没有统计某一列时,它的值显示为null,这可能与列本身就有null值冲突,这就需要一种方法区分是没有统计还是值本来就是null。(写一个排列组合的算法,就马上理解了,grouping_id其实就是所统计各列二进制和) ...

相关热词 c# 挂机锁 c# 不能再打开其它表了 c#移除行 c#socket建立通信 c# 拦截socket c#做一个问卷调查 c++结构体转换为c# c# 判断组合键 c# 的类 重写dll c# 五层嵌套 优化